SINCERELY YOURS WEDDING COLLECTION

Celebrate your big day in effortless style with the Sincerely Yours Wedding Collection from Flower Delivery Dartford. Thoughtfully designed wedding flower packages make it easy to create a romantic, cohesive look for your ceremony and reception. Choose from Intimate (50-75 guests), Original (75-100 guests) or Ultimate (100+ guests) packages, each including a stunning bridal bouquet, matching bridesmaid bouquets and elegant groom boutonnieres. Our expert florists handcraft every arrangement with fresh, premium blooms to suit your colour palette and wedding theme, from classic and timeless to modern and chic.
